    Script Writer

    Key Responsibilities

    • Develop, research, and write engaging scripts for TV, Radio, and digital productions.
    • Collaborate with producers, directors, and creative teams to shape storylines and concepts.
    • Adapt ideas and concepts into clear, compelling, and audience - focused scripts.
    • Edit and revise scripts based on feedback to meet creative and production needs.
    • Ensure scripts align with brand objectives, project goals, and audience expectations.
    • Meet deadlines and deliver quality work in a fast - paced production environment.

    Requirements

    • A Degree in Mass Communication, English, Theatre Arts, Creative Writing, or a related field.
    • 2 years Proven experience as a script writer in media, TV, radio, or production.
    • Strong storytelling, writing, and editing skills.
    • Ability to generate creative ideas and transform them into production-ready scripts.
    • Excellent communication and teamwork skills.
    • Must reside within Ikeja, Ogba, Omole, Agege, or Ojodu Berger due to office proximity.
